#5bf343 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5bf343 is composed of 35.7% red, 95.3% green and 26.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 72.4% yellow and 4.7% black. It has a hue angle of 111.8 degrees, a saturation of 88% and a lightness of 60.8%. #5bf343 color hex could be obtained by blending #b6ff86 with #00e700. Closest websafe color is: #66ff33.

Shades and Tints of #5bf343

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030f01 is the darkest color, while #fcfffb is the lightest one.
